Claremont junior Kori Carter more than made up for a lackluster showing in her preliminary heat to win the championship in the girls’ 100 meter hurdles, finishing in 13.59 seconds--the fastest time in the nation this year.

We’ll see if Carter can duplicate that feat in the 300 hurdles after failing to win her preliminary heat Friday.

Diamond Ranch’s Karynn Dunn was third in the 100 hurdles in 13.96.
